What you’ll do 

As a People Development Partner on Stripe’s People Development team (part of the Talent & Development org), you will play an instrumental role in developing Stripes through a variety of user-focused learning programs and experiences. This person will have broad expertise in the people development space, including content design and development, program management, project management, and virtual and IRL facilitation. The ideal candidate is a highly proactive self-motivator who has a pulse on the latest trends in talent development and a proven track record of designing, delivering, and evaluating exceptional learning experiences aligned to business strategy.

Responsibilities

  •  Learning experience design

    • Own the learning experience design process end-to-end from intake to delivery
    • Leverage a users-first, data-driven approach to design highly relevant, highly impactful People Development product offerings that support Stripe’s strategy
    • Support key Stripe initiatives by owning, designing, and developing suites of enablement assets including job aids, manager guides, and live/virtual training sessions
    • Partner with Stripe leaders to operationalize Stripe’s strategy and culture through People Development products
  • Program management

    • Architect and execute programs and experiences that support Stripe employees at global scale and at different career moments
    • Manage People Development programs end-to-end, including designing, marketing, facilitating, and evaluating program content
    • Qualitatively and quantitatively assess and improve the effectiveness of programs to demonstrate impact in line with business objectives
  • Project management

    • Collaborate with cross-functional stakeholders and subject matter experts during the design and development process, establishing project timelines, addressing user feedback, and ensuring alignment, engagement, and expectation management
    • Consult with business leaders to understand their needs and solicit their input, appropriate sponsorship, engagement, and alignment
  • Facilitation

    • Facilitate and/or work with facilitators to deliver ongoing developmental experiences (primarily virtually via Zoom, some IRL)

Hybrid work at Stripe

Office-assigned Stripes spend at least 50% of the time in a given month in their local office or with users. This hits a balance between bringing people together for in-person collaboration and learning from each other, while supporting flexibility about how to do this in a way that makes sense for individuals and their teams.
